Colorado governor Jared Polis loves to be called libertarian. A new proposal from the

The Colorado Department of Labor and Employment and the Governor’s Office would require Colorado employers to notify employees of eligibility for a bunch of state and federal tax credits. CDLE’s argument is simple: The believe that such notification will make more people aware of their ability to take other people’s money. No, they don’t word it that way but that’s what this is. I actually don’t know if the governor is even aware of the proposal. I have asked him but don’t have a response yet. I look forward to thanking him on air for killing this ridiculous intrusion and expense for business managers and this magnet for nuisance lawsuits. But I’m not holding my breath.

For a couple of days, conservative Twitter was all atwitter with cries of "Apple is going to remove Twitter from the App Store." I asked (on Twitter) why people believe that since the only person who made the claim was Elon Musk, and it was probably more like weak innuendo than a full claim. Musk met with Apple CEO Tim Cook on Wednesday and said that "Apple had never considered" removing Twitter from the App Store. Man, people believe nonsense so easily if it fits their political (and other) biases.

The House of Representatives passed a bill to prevent a railroad strike but added another bill to give the railroad workers an additional 7 days of paid sick leave. The latter won't pass the Senate. Not sure if it's good politics but Dems can't help themselves when siding with unions.
